I was following a tutorial to downgrade my N3DS which was on 9.9 or something, and, after running SafeSysUpdater to check the N3DS update files (it said that they were all good), I used the downgrade option on sysUpdater.
However it crashed during the downgrade.

When I restarted the console, the version was at 9.2, but the downgrade checker said that two titles have mismatched versions and one extra title is red.

So I ran SafeSysUpdater again but used the downgrade option this time.
When it finished, it said to power off the system if it did not restart in 10 seconds of trying. I gave it around a minute and then manually powered off the console.

Unfortunately, the downgrade checker still says the same thing.

Also, I cannot boot rxTools or ReiNand either (both go to a black screen, and the console needs to be reset)
I am thinking that it is because of the above problem, but I am not completely sure.

I am not sure what went wrong or how to fix this...

Keep trying what though?
Also, if I keep doing whatever it is that you are saying to, it will not brick will it?
Keep trying the downgrade.
If you get a black screen while turning it on try taking out the SD card.
If that works, then try reinstalling menuhax (or whatever you used) and try the downgrade again.

There's always a chance of bricking with a downgrade.
I had the same thing happen to me (got a soft brick), and the second time it worked it did a full downgrade.

Can you post the downgrade checker log?

It seems your downgrade completed successfully.

--------------------- MERGED ---------------------------

what are the 2 files?
the extra one is amiibo settings and wont go away unless u uninstall it
GPIO and DSP aren't in the downgrade pack. You need to install them from an O3DS 9.2 pack.
